Pedestrian Killed In Coquitlam, B.C., Crash Identified As 13-Year-Old Girl

Darpan News Desk, 27 Mar, 2019 02:18 AM

    COQUITLAM, B.C. — Police say a 13-year-old girl was the pedestrian who died after a collision on Monday at an intersection in Coquitlam, B.C.

     

    The RCMP say the crash happened between a Dodge Charger travelling southbound on Mariner Way and intending to turn left onto Riverview Crescent and a BMW travelling northbound.


    The Mounties say the impact of the collision caused the BMW to spin onto the raised traffic island where five children were standing: three girls aged 17, 13 and 10, and two boys aged 11 and 6.


    Two of the children — the 13-year-old-girl and the six-year-old-boy — were taken to hospital with serious injuries.


    Soon after arriving at the hospital, police say the girl succumbed to her injuries.


    The BC Coroners Service is also investigating.
